Mechanical Stabilization of Subgrade Using Sand–Cement Mixture

2021 
An attempt to stabilize the black cotton soil (BCS) using locally available sand with cement mixture has been presented in this study. The soil in the western part of the India is predominated by the black cotton soil which causes lot of problems for the road construction. Replacement with well-graded borrow soil for subgrade is not economical solutions for the road construction. In India, several road constructions have been proposed on this problematic terrain. For this purpose, different proportion of sand–cement mixture has been used to improve the engineering properties of the BCS. The mixture of 60% sand and 2% cement resulted in increase in the CBR value by about 120% as compared to the lime-stabilized BCS.
